I am in a similar situation, so I try to volunteer my time instead of money. Ideally, I would also give money, but you do what you can. One way to look at it is how much is your time worth? I make about $8.15 an hour, so I consider one hour of service to be a donation of $8.15. Then it’s easy to figure out how many hours you need to work to “give” 10%. This service does not have to be out of the house. You could do extra chores or errands for family members. Fasting can be a service to God more directly.
